More Books by Brian Doyle The Plover. 2014 The Square of Revenge. 2013 Martin Marten. 2015 Grace Notes. 2011 The Midas Murders. 2013 The Adventures of John Carson in Several Quarters of the World. 2024 WebBrian Doyle (American writer) Brian James Patrick Doyle was an American writer. [1] [2] He was a recipient of the American Academy of Arts and Letters Award in Literature and three Pushcart Prizes. [3] [4] He lived with his wife and three children in Portland, Oregon. In May 2024, he died at the age of 60 due to a brain tumour. Webreview essay The Essay-Lover’s Guide to Brian Doyle Patrick Madden H ello. This is a synopsis-review of Brian Doyle’s work, mostly his books, which as of this writing (early 2024) number 28, but also of his unbooked essays, and perhaps of his life, too. WebApr 5, 2016 · Fiction Review "Chicago" by Brian Doyle April 5, 2016 at 9:00 am by Toni Nealie A Mark Twain-like adventure based on the author’s memories of five seasons spent in Chicago right after college, Brian Doyle’s “Chicago” is a loving, lingering look at the indelible mark the city left on him.

WebMar 29, 2016 · by Brian Doyle ‧ RELEASE DATE: March 29, 2016. A nameless college graduate arrives in Chicago at the end of a 1970s summer. In his 15 months there, he … WebFor those who love Doyle, you will undoubtedly fall into this novel. A first-person tale immersed within Chicago, like his previous novels it has its wandering, semicolon-driven lists, its comfortable dose of magical realism with talking animals, and its guiding, historical muse [in this case, Abraham Lincoln, but not nearly as overt as in his previous works].
